Pan-Roasted Salmon with Ginger and Curry |
|
 |
Prep Time: 15 Minutes Cook Time: 0 Minutes |
Ready In: 15 Minutes Servings: 2 |
|
If you’re in the mood for an Asian-inspired meal, serve this fish with the pickled cucumber and cabbage. Ingredients:
2 teaspoons minced peeled fresh ginger |
1 teaspoon curry powder |
2 (6 ounces) pieces center-cut salmon fillet with skin, patted dry |
1 tablespoon olive oil |
3 scallions, chopped |
Directions:
1. Stir together ginger and curry and season with salt and pepper. Pat spice mixture onto flesh sides of salmon. Heat oil in a nonstick skillet over moderate heat until hot but not smoking, then cook salmon, skin sides down, covered, 5 minutes. Turn salmon over and cook, covered, until just cooked through, about 2 minutes more. 2. Add scallions to skillet with salmon and cook 30 seconds. |
